Зачем фиксировать строки в Excel и когда это необходимо
Работа с большими таблицами в Microsoft Excel или Google Sheets часто превращается в головоломку, когда заголовки столбцов «уезжают» за пределы экрана при прокрутке. Представьте: вы анализируете отчёт на 500 строк, и каждую секунду приходится возвращаться в начало, чтобы вспомнить, что означает столбец D или F. Закрепление строк решает эту проблему раз и навсегда.
Фиксация первых трёх строк актуальна в трёх ключевых сценариях: 1) Когда в таблице многоуровневые заголовки (например, строка 1 — название отчёта, строка 2 — период, строка 3 — имена столбцов). 2) При работе с данными, где первые строки содержат фильтры или сводные формулы. 3) В шаблонах, где верхние строки — это инструкции или легенда для остальных данных.
Без закрепления вы рискуете запутаться в собственных данных или случайно изменить формулы в «шапке» таблицы.
Важно понимать разницу между закреплением областей (freeze panes) и разделением окна (split). Первый метод «приклеивает» строки/столбцы при прокрутке, а второй просто делит экран на независимые зоны. Для нашей задачи нужен именно Freeze Panes.
Способ 1: Классическое закрепление через меню (Excel 2010–2026)
Это универсальный метод, работающий во всех версиях Excel для Windows и Mac. Алгоритм одинаковый, но расположение кнопок может незначительно отличаться.
- Выделите строку под закрепляемым блоком. Чтобы зафиксировать первые 3 строки, кликните на ячейку
A4(или любую ячейку в 4-й строке). Это сигнал для Excel: «Всё, что выше выделенной ячейки, нужно закрепить». - Перейдите на вкладку
Вид. В ленте инструментов найдите разделОкно. - Нажмите
Закрепить области→Закрепить области. После этого первые 3 строки останутся на месте при прокрутке.
⚠️ Внимание: Если после закрепления вы видите серую линию между 3-й и 4-й строками — это нормально. Она обозначает границу закреплённой области. Не пытайтесь её перетащить: это не изменит зону фиксации, а только визуально разделит экран.
Выделена ячейка A4 (или любая в 4-й строке)|
На вкладке "Вид" выбрано "Закрепить области"|
Серые линии появились под 3-й строкой|
При прокрутке вниз строки 1–3 остаются на месте-->
Способ 2: Горячие клавиши для быстрого закрепления
Для опытных пользователей, которые ценят скорость, есть комбинации клавиш. Они работают в Excel 2013 и новее (включая Office 365):
- 🔹
Alt + W + F + F— закрепить области (после выделения ячейкиA4). - 🔹
Alt + W + F + R— закрепить только верхнюю строку (если нужно вернуть стандартное состояние). - 🔹
Alt + W + F + C— отменить закрепление.
Важный нюанс: На Mac вместо Alt используйте Option, а вместо W — Command. Например: Option + Command + W + F + F.
Если горячие клавиши не срабатывают, проверьте:
1) Не конфликтуют ли они с клавишами вашей ОС (например, в Windows некоторые комбинации могут быть заняты системными функциями).
2) Включён ли режим Num Lock — он может блокировать часть сочетаний.
Excel 2010–2016|
Excel 2019–2021|
Office 365 (подписка)|
Excel для Mac|
Excel Online (браузерная версия)-->
Способ 3: Закрепление в Excel Online и Google Sheets
Веб-версии табличных редакторов имеют упрощённый интерфейс, но функцию закрепления строк там тоже реализовали. В Excel Online:
- Выделите ячейку
A4. - Нажмите
Вид→Закрепить строки→Закрепить до строки 3.
В Google Sheets алгоритм другой:
1) Выделите строку 4 (кликните на её номер слева).
2) Перейдите в меню Вид → Закрепить → До текущей строки (3).
⚠️ Внимание: В Google Sheets нельзя закрепить одновременно строки и столбцы через веб-интерфейс. Для этого придётся использовать расширение Google Apps Script или перейти в настольную версию Excel.
| Платформа | Макс. кол-во закреплённых строк | Поддержка столбцов | Горячие клавиши |
|---|---|---|---|
| Excel для Windows | Неограничено | Да | Alt + W + F + F |
| Excel для Mac | Неограничено | Да | Option + Command + W + F + F |
| Excel Online | До 10 строк | Нет | — |
| Google Sheets | До 5 строк | Только через скрипты | — |
Распространённые ошибки и как их исправить
Если после закрепления строки всё равно прокручиваются, проверьте, не включён ли режим «Разделить окно» (Split). Эти функции конфликтуют: при активном разделении закрепление не работает. Чтобы устранить проблему:
- Перейдите на вкладку
Вид→Снять разделение. - Повторите процедуру закрепления.
Другие типичные ошибки:
- 🚫 Выделена не та ячейка. Если кликнуть на
A3вместоA4, закрепится только 2 строки. Всегда выделяйте строку ниже последней фиксируемой. - 🚫 Закрепление не применяется к фильтрам. Если в строке 3 установлен фильтр (
Данные → Фильтр), он останется на месте, но стрелки фильтрации могут «съехать» при прокрутке. Решение: закрепите строку выше фильтра (например,A2для фильтра в строке 3). - 🚫 Серые линии мешают работе. Их нельзя убрать, но можно сделать менее заметными: уменьшите масштаб листа (
Вид → Масштаб).
Почему в Excel 2007 нет кнопки "Закрепить области"?
В Excel 2007 функция называется "Закрепить области", но находится в другом месте: вкладка "Вид" → группа "Окно" → кнопка "Закрепить области". Интерфейс ленты в этой версии отличается от современных, но логика работы та же.
Продвинутые приёмы: закрепление строк и столбцов одновременно
Иногда требуется зафиксировать не только строки, но и столбцы — например, чтобы при прокрутке всегда были видны и заголовки строк (столбец A), и заголовки столбцов (строки 1–3). Для этого:
- Выделите ячейку
B4(пересечение 4-й строки и 2-го столбца). - Перейдите на вкладку
Вид→Закрепить области→Закрепить области.
Теперь при прокрутке:
→ Столбец A и строки 1–3 останутся на месте.
→ Остальная часть таблицы будет прокручиваться независимо.
⚠️ Внимание: В Google Sheets такой фокус не пройдёт — там можно закрепить либо строки, либо столбцы, но не одновременно. Для обходного решения используйте надстройку Power Tools или Advanced Find and Replace.
Автоматизация: макрос для закрепления строк в один клик
Если вы регулярно работаете с таблицами одинаковой структуры, имеет смысл записать макрос. Он будет закреплять первые 3 строки по нажатию одной кнопки. Инструкция для Excel:
- Нажмите
Alt + F11, чтобы открыть редактор VBA. - Выберите
Insert → Module. - Вставьте код:
Sub FreezeTopThreeRows()ActiveWindow.FreezePanes = False
Rows("4:4").Select
ActiveWindow.FreezePanes = True
End Sub
- Закройте редактор и назначьте макросу сочетание клавиш:
Файл → Параметры → Настройка ленты → Сочетания клавиш.
Теперь достаточно нажать назначенную комбинацию (например, Ctrl + Shift + F), и первые 3 строки будут закреплены автоматически. Преимущество метода: макрос сработает даже если вы забудете, какую ячейку нужно выделять.
FAQ: Ответы на частые вопросы
Можно ли закрепить не подряд идущие строки (например, 1-ю и 3-ю)?
Нет, в стандартном функционале Excel закрепляются только непрерывные блоки строк или столбцов. Обходной путь: скопируйте нужные строки в отдельный лист и закрепите их там, а затем вернитесь к основной таблице. Или используйте надстройку Kutools for Excel, которая позволяет закреплять произвольные области.
Почему после закрепления исчезла полоса прокрутки?
Это визуальный баг, связанный с масштабом экрана. Попробуйте:
1) Уменьшить масштаб до 80–90% (Вид → Масштаб).
2) Перезапустить Excel.
3) Отменить закрепление и применить его заново.
Если проблема остаётся, обновите Office до последней версии.
Как закрепить строки в защищённом листе?
Закрепление строк не конфликтует с защитой листа. Вы можете фиксировать области даже если лист защищён паролем. Однако, если вы пытаетесь изменить закреплённые строки (например, отредактировать ячейку в строке 1), Excel запросит пароль для снятия защиты.
Возможно ли закрепить строки в мобильной версии Excel?
В официальных приложениях Excel для Android/iOS функции закрепления строк нет. Альтернативы: 1) Использовать браузерную версию Excel Online (ограниченная поддержка). 2) Установить сторонние приложения, например, AndrOpen Office или Polaris Office, где эта функция реализована.
Как убрать серые линии после закрепления?
Серые линии — это визуальные разделители закреплённой области. Их нельзя убрать полностью, но можно сделать менее заметными:
1) Уменьшите масштаб листа (Вид → Масштаб → 80%).
2) Измените цвет линий через настройки тем в Excel (Файл → Параметры → Общие → Темы).
3) В Excel 2019+ линии становятся почти прозрачными при масштабе ниже 70%.